Wells Gardner - D9400 - Setup Questions for Mame
« on: October 06, 2007, 09:35:31 am »
I have a Wells Gardner - WGM2794-U0FS05S
27" Flat Model D9400 Digitally Controlled Monitor. RCA CRT. Includes VGA and Power Cables. Frame Type: Universal (UO)

What do I need to do to get the video to display from my computer on it?  It has VGA built into it.  Do I need to use powerstrip on it?  I thought it worked right out of the box.  It displays no signal on the screen.  What am I missing here?  I am in need of some help.  Thanks!

Re: Wells Gardner - D9400 - Setup Questions for Mame
« Reply #3 on: October 10, 2007, 06:42:56 pm »
You are probably feeding it a resolution it doesn't support.  Try setting your desktop to 640x480 using a PC monitor, and then hook up the D9400 and reboot.

PS you should probably get an ArcadeVGA video card if you don't already have one.
